IIRC we first had this conversation about a month after launch. Downvotes have always been used to express disagreement. Or more precisely, a negative score has: users seem not to downvote something they disagree with if it already has a sufficiently negative score.

seems like we have this discussion like once a week. i have several comments in similar threads that are all now under dead submissions.

i think the better point to be made is that people downvote opinions that they don't agree with (as opposed to downvoting something factually inaccurate or bad in some other way). its good to have different points of view, and if people get punished for expressing the unpopular one, fewer people will express them.
